Description
The Fagge Bone Elevator is used to lift periosteum and separate soft tissue when the bone needs to be exposed during surgery. It is used for orthopedic, trauma, and reconstructive procedures, including work around fractures and bone grafting.
The working end has a broad, spatulated blade. Its smooth surface provides a wider area for lifting tissue from the bone. The shape is useful when the surgeon needs to expose a section of bone rather than work with a narrow point.
The elevator measures 27.5 cm (10¾”) overall. The extra length gives it useful reach for deeper operative areas and provides leverage when lifting tissue. The handle is shaped to keep the instrument steady in the hand while it is being positioned or moved along the bone.
The Fagge Bone Elevator can be used for periosteal elevation, soft tissue separation, and bone exposure during procedures such as fracture fixation, bone grafting, and reconstructive surgery. Its broad blade gives the user a larger working surface for these tasks.
